150
|
1 include_directories(${CMAKE_CURRENT_SOURCE_DIR}/..)
|
|
2
|
|
3 add_clang_tool(clang-include-fixer
|
|
4 ClangIncludeFixer.cpp
|
|
5 )
|
|
6
|
|
7 clang_target_link_libraries(clang-include-fixer
|
|
8 PRIVATE
|
|
9 clangBasic
|
|
10 clangFormat
|
|
11 clangFrontend
|
|
12 clangRewrite
|
|
13 clangSerialization
|
|
14 clangTooling
|
|
15 clangToolingCore
|
|
16 )
|
|
17 target_link_libraries(clang-include-fixer
|
|
18 PRIVATE
|
|
19 clangIncludeFixer
|
|
20 findAllSymbols
|
|
21 )
|
|
22
|
|
23 install(PROGRAMS clang-include-fixer.el
|
|
24 DESTINATION share/clang
|
|
25 COMPONENT clang-include-fixer)
|
|
26 install(PROGRAMS clang-include-fixer.py
|
|
27 DESTINATION share/clang
|
|
28 COMPONENT clang-include-fixer)
|